What is Generative Engine Optimization?

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) refers to the process through which websites optimize their content to enable AI search engines to understand, trust and use their data when creating answers for users. As opposed to traditional SEO, which involves ranking web pages, GEO ensures that the content is used to create responses.

As the AI search engines continue to expand and increase, companies are becoming interested in GEO marketing since they can keep their websites visible to modern search engines. This is why several marketers have started researching AI search engine optimization.

Why is Generative Engine Optimization Rising in 2026?

One of the main reasons driving GEOis the increasing trend of AI searches. The new generation of users expects to receive fast and relevant results without browsing through various websites. Through AI technology, information from various sources is analyzed and complete answers are created within a few seconds. 

The above trend can also be associated with Google AI Overview SEO, where Google offers users an AI-powered summary right inside the search result page. Due to such changes, businesses using traditional SEO may experience problems and become invisible unless they start using AI SEO strategies.

In addition, one of the key factors driving GEO SEO is related to voice search, AI assistants, and conversational search experience. Nowadays, users tend to ask complex queries and get comprehensive answers from AI, and therefore content quality has become extremely crucial.

How to Do Generative Engine Optimization

Many companies are wondering about how to do Generative Engine Optimization efficiently. First and foremost, one needs to create top-notch content that would provide an answer to the user’s query.

Some important Generative Engine Optimization strategies include:

  • Writing clear and helpful content
  • Using question-and-answer formats
  • Creating trustworthy information
  • Improving website authority
  • Updating content regularly
  • Using structured headings and subheadings

These GEO strategies help AI systems understand content more effectively and increase the chances of appearing in AI-generated responses.
